Что такое веб-хостинг и как он работает?
В современном мире интернета трудно представить себе жизнь без сайтов. Каждый день мы посещаем множество интернет-ресурсов для работы, учебы, развлечений и общения. Но чтобы сайт стал доступен пользователям, ему нужно где-то «жить» – именно эту задачу решает веб-хостинг.
Что такое веб-хостинг?
Веб-хостинг – это услуга, которая предоставляет пространство на сервере для размещения файлов вашего сайта, чтобы они были доступны через интернет. Сервер – это мощный компьютер, который круглосуточно подключен к сети и хранит все данные вашего сайта: тексты, изображения, видео, скрипты и другие файлы. Когда пользователь вводит адрес вашего сайта в браузере, запрос отправляется на этот сервер, а тот возвращает необходимые файлы, формируя страницу, которую видит посетитель.
Как работает веб-хостинг?
Процесс работы веб-хостинга довольно прост:
- Регистрация домена. Чтобы ваш сайт был доступен под определенным именем (например, example.com), вам необходимо зарегистрировать доменное имя у регистратора доменов. Домен связывает IP-адрес сервера с понятным человеку названием.
- Выбор хостинга. После регистрации доменного имени вы выбираете компанию-провайдера, предоставляющую услуги веб-хостинга. Она выделяет вам определенное количество ресурсов на своем сервере (дисковое пространство, оперативную память, процессорное время), необходимых для хранения и обработки данных вашего сайта.
- Размещение файлов сайта. Вы загружаете файлы своего сайта на выделенный сервер через FTP (File Transfer Protocol) или панель управления хостингом. Эти файлы могут включать HTML-страницы, стили CSS, скрипты JavaScript, базы данных и медиафайлы.
- Доступность сайта. Теперь, когда ваши файлы размещены на сервере, пользователи могут получить доступ к вашему сайту, введя его URL в браузер. Запросы пользователей обрабатываются сервером, и соответствующие страницы отображаются в их браузерах.
Виды веб-хостинга
Существует несколько типов веб-хостинга, каждый из которых подходит для разных целей и бюджетов:
- Shared Hosting (Общий хостинг)Это самый популярный и экономичный вариант. На одном физическом сервере размещается множество сайтов, и ресурсы (процессор, память, дисковое пространство) распределяются между ними. Этот вид хостинга идеален для небольших проектов, блогов и стартапов.
- VPS (Virtual Private Server)VPS представляет собой виртуальный сервер, который эмулирует работу физического сервера. Хотя физически сервер делится между несколькими пользователями, каждому выделяется гарантированный объем ресурсов, что обеспечивает большую стабильность и производительность по сравнению с общим хостингом.
- Dedicated Server (Выделенный сервер)Здесь клиент получает в свое распоряжение целый физический сервер. Это наиболее дорогой, но и самый производительный вариант, подходящий для крупных проектов с высокими требованиями к ресурсам и безопасности.
- Cloud Hosting (Облачный хостинг)Облачный хостинг использует распределенную сеть серверов, что позволяет гибко масштабировать ресурсы в зависимости от нагрузки. Если ваш сайт внезапно становится популярным, облачные технологии позволяют быстро увеличить мощность, избегая перегрузок.
- Reseller Hosting (Реселлерский хостинг)Этот вид хостинга предназначен для тех, кто хочет предоставлять услуги хостинга другим клиентам. Реселлеры получают возможность управлять своими клиентами и настраивать тарифы, используя ресурсы основного провайдера.
- Colocation (Колокация)При колокации клиент размещает свой собственный сервер в дата-центре провайдера. Провайдер обеспечивает подключение к интернету, электропитание и охлаждение, а также физическую безопасность оборудования.
Основные характеристики веб-хостинга
При выборе хостинга важно учитывать следующие параметры:
- Объем дискового пространства: сколько места доступно для хранения ваших файлов.
- Ограничения трафика: сколько данных может передаваться за определенный период времени.
- Количество баз данных: поддержка различных систем управления базами данных (MySQL, PostgreSQL и др.).
- Панель управления: удобный интерфейс для управления вашим аккаунтом и файлами.
- Поддержка языков программирования: PHP, Python, Ruby и другие.
- Безопасность: наличие SSL-сертификатов, резервного копирования, защиты от DDoS-атак.
- Техническая поддержка: круглосуточная помощь специалистов при возникновении проблем.
Заключение
Веб-хостинг играет ключевую роль в обеспечении доступности вашего сайта в интернете. Правильный выбор типа хостинга и компании-провайдера поможет обеспечить стабильную работу вашего ресурса, защитить его от угроз и предоставить лучший опыт для посетителей.
В этом контексте мы рекомендуем обратить внимание на – ADMINVPS, который сочетает в себе надежность, профессиональную поддержку и разумные тарифы. Примите мудрое решение сегодня, чтобы Ваш веб-проект процветал завтра. Начать пользоваться – ADMINVPS.